martes, 27 de marzo de 2012

Cambiar Colores con VB

Buenas Bloggeros

Hoy haremos algo facil espero les entretenga.
Lo que haremos es que con comandos de VB podamos cambiar el formato de un texto o cierto documento en excel.

Aca esta el formato que usaremos para poder grabar las 3 macros y asi poder generar lo que es el boton para poder cambiar los colores a voluntad.


Seleccionamo en el menu vista luego en macros luego grabar macro y seleccionamos los colores para cada estilo. Aca muestro como grabar la macro:


Ahora lo que sigue es grabar las macros como ya dimos click en grabar macro solo es de generar el formato con los colores deseados.


Recuerden que deben precionar el recuadro que lesseñale para detener la macro.


Asi les tendria que cambiar el boton al detener la macro.

Crean sus tres formatos de la misma manera y despues creamos el boton para el intercambio de los formatos asi:


Ya creado el boton devemos agregarle el codigo para que este cambie el tipo de formato.
Luego precionamos la tecla Alt+F11 para que despliegue el modulo en el que estan todos sus macros como lo varean en la imagen siguiente:


Luego lo que tenemos que hacer es condicionar cada uno de los codigos con If [E2] = 1 Then porque en E2 tenemos el espacio para poner el tipo de formato y haci lo hacemos con cada uno solo variando el numero de formato que tendremos asi:


Luego guardamos el documento como un documento de excel habilitado para macros y presionamos F5 para probar y nos damos cuenta que al precionar el boton cambio de formato funciona a la perfeccion.


Y asi terminamos este ejercicio espero les sirva para ahorrarse tiempo y cualquier duda o sugerencia sera bienvenida :D

No hay comentarios:

Publicar un comentario